About (3R)-1-[6-[[5-chloro-6-(2-methylphenyl)-2-pyridinyl]sulfamoyl]-2-pyridinyl]-3-methylpiperidine-3-carboxylic acid

(3R)-1-[6-[[5-chloro-6-(2-methylphenyl)-2-pyridinyl]sulfamoyl]-2-pyridinyl]-3-methylpiperidine-3-carboxylic acid (PubChem CID 134328854) has the molecular formula C24H25ClN4O4S and a molecular weight of 501.01 g/mol. Its IUPAC name is (3R)-1-[6-[[5-chloro-6-(2-methylphenyl)-2-pyridinyl]sulfamoyl]-2-pyridinyl]-3-methylpiperidine-3-carboxylic acid.
